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1581 0761154 17 155303600
36108442 86321629786 30230312788
36108442 86321629786 30230312788
508654 25601455001 293
All about undefined
Interested in learning more?
36108442 86321629786 30230312788
508654 25601455001 293
See more
981820 979 560
25 3092 6543036312 341 2515007512
See more
8017754 771596610
08905200 9260 60 8512597
See more